What Makes a Good Bail Bond Agency?
Not all bail bond agencies are created equal. Here's what to look for when choosing a bondsman in Washington County:
- Florida licensing — Verify through the Florida Department of Financial Services
- 24/7 availability — Arrests happen at all hours; your bondsman should too
- Transparent pricing — The rate is always 10%, no hidden fees
- Fast response — A good agency responds within minutes, not hours
- Payment plans — Flexible financing options make bail accessible
Red Flags to Watch For
- Rates advertised below 10% (illegal in Florida)
- No physical office or business address
- Pressure to sign without reading paperwork
- Refusal to provide their license number
- Demands for the full bail amount upfront

Choosing an Agent Near Washington County Jail
When selecting a bail bond agency for someone at Washington County Jail (711 3rd St, Chipley, FL), proximity matters less than you think. Most Washington County bondsmen can post bail remotely and have established relationships with the jail staff. What matters most is licensing, response time, and payment flexibility.
